The museum is located in Tahrir Square and consists of two floors containing more than 160,000 rare archaeological items, including mummies which belonging to Egypt's pharaohs. The museum is organized according to the history of the exhibits; in the first floor you will see the large-sized monuments and the second floor featuring royal mummies, manuscripts, statues and others, stir to visit Cairo Citadel of Salah El Din, Resembling a typical early medieval fortress, with large imposing gateways, towers and high defending walls, the Citadel is one of Cairo’s main attractions and probably the most popular non-Pharaonic monument in the Egyptian capital. The prominent fortress houses three mosques – of which the impressive Mohamed Ali Mosque – a carriage museum, a military museum, and a garden museum, just to name a few, and they are all worth a visit.
